<?xml version="1.0" encoding="utf-8"?>
<rss version="2.0"><channel><title>Recent changes to patches</title><link>http://sourceforge.net/p/csound/patches/</link><description>Recent changes to patches</description><language>en</language><lastBuildDate>Fri, 07 Dec 2012 19:02:34 -0000</lastBuildDate><item><title>#2 wrong usage of strncat</title><link>http://sourceforge.net/p/csound/patches/_discuss/thread/8c850718/</link><description>- **status**: open --&gt; wont-fix
- **milestone**:  --&gt; 
</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">John ffitch</dc:creator><pubDate>Fri, 07 Dec 2012 19:02:34 -0000</pubDate><guid>http://sourceforge.netbfe78937ec78a98c890de6631d9684880f829f34</guid></item><item><title>#1 wrong usage of memset</title><link>http://sourceforge.net/p/csound/patches/_discuss/thread/fb512936/</link><description>- **status**: open --&gt; accepted
- **milestone**:  --&gt; 
</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">John ffitch</dc:creator><pubDate>Fri, 07 Dec 2012 19:00:43 -0000</pubDate><guid>http://sourceforge.netf361d2e1d51685c56c8cf62f1ba877ac34ab9df8</guid></item><item><title>Some out of bounds access / NULL pointer dereference bugs</title><link>http://sourceforge.net/p/csound/patches/3/</link><description>I ran the csound source code through cppcheck, which found a small number of real bugs, including out of bounds access of some arrays, and NULL pointer dereferences, and one case of an \} not balanced by a extern "C" \{ inside an \#ifdef \_\_cplusplus.

It also found several resource leaks \(from filedescriptors and malloc\(\)ed memory\), but I only fixed two very trivial ones, and they seemed mostly harmless anyway.</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Guus Sliepen</dc:creator><pubDate>Mon, 09 Jan 2012 22:45:07 -0000</pubDate><guid>http://sourceforge.netbfcb806335dec41010f142bd93d7635f8af98c63</guid></item><item><title>wrong usage of strncat</title><link>http://sourceforge.net/p/csound/patches/2/</link><description>wrong usage of strncat, see attached patch</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Pavol Rusnak</dc:creator><pubDate>Sun, 08 Jan 2012 16:00:26 -0000</pubDate><guid>http://sourceforge.net3064129e1ddc6ea366d0f6e4b7b4e748e8c9b7b0</guid></item><item><title>wrong usage of strncat</title><link>http://sourceforge.net/p/csound/patches/2/</link><description>Ticket 2 has been modified: wrong usage of strncat
Edited By: John ffitch (jpff)
Status updated: u'open' =&gt; u'wont-fix'</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Pavol Rusnak</dc:creator><pubDate>Sun, 08 Jan 2012 16:00:26 -0000</pubDate><guid>http://sourceforge.net324916cec01bf43154c7cbddfdda639920c9403c</guid></item><item><title>wrong usage of memset</title><link>http://sourceforge.net/p/csound/patches/1/</link><description>wrong usage of memset, see attached patch</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Pavol Rusnak</dc:creator><pubDate>Sun, 08 Jan 2012 16:00:05 -0000</pubDate><guid>http://sourceforge.net5329f178ca67e5625555d0db4940943904b714f3</guid></item><item><title>wrong usage of memset</title><link>http://sourceforge.net/p/csound/patches/1/</link><description>Ticket 1 has been modified: wrong usage of memset
Edited By: John ffitch (jpff)
Status updated: u'open' =&gt; u'accepted'</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Pavol Rusnak</dc:creator><pubDate>Sun, 08 Jan 2012 16:00:05 -0000</pubDate><guid>http://sourceforge.neta634bb0e5d6e0282982804adf72563d236b2232a</guid></item></channel></rss>